🎯 Quick Answer
To get your Naan Flatbreads recommended by AI search engines like ChatGPT and Perplexity, ensure your product data includes detailed schema markup, high-quality images, verified reviews highlighting freshness and authentic ingredients, and FAQ content addressing common customer questions. Regularly update product information and monitor review signals to maintain discoverability.
